In a concerning development for cybersecurity, a more sophisticated version of the infamous macOS-focused malware, Banshee Stealer, has emerged. This updated malware variant poses a significant threat to over 100 million macOS users globally. Known for its stealth and advanced encryption mechanisms, the new Banshee Stealer is alarming cybersecurity experts, particularly due to its ability to bypass antivirus systems effectively. A New and Improved Threat Banshee Stealer first came to light in August 2024, uncovered by Elastic Security Labs. The rise of artificial intelligence (AI) has revolutionized industries, but it has also introduced significant challenges to cybersecurity. One alarming trend is the ability of AI, particularly large language models (LLMs), to generate malware variants at scale, enhancing their evasion capabilities against advanced detection systems. Recent research sheds light on how AI can create over 10,000 malware variants while maintaining their functionality, bypassing detection in 88% of cases. This development poses a grave threat to cybersecurity systems worldwide.
